Introduction to Augmented Reality
Mainstream "augmented reality" is one in all those technologies that all the time appears to be on the horizon, up there with jetpacks, flying cars, and robotic housekeepers. But in actual fact, there are already a variety of functional and fun AR smartphone apps which are road-ready. The most typical idea with these, for the uninitiated, is that you simply point your smartphone camera at something (an object, a street, an attraction) and immediately, pop-up cards of knowledge about that thing will appear onscreen—particularly useful for travelers.

WikiTude
What you may call an AR aggregator, WikiTude relies on tons of other content sources (like Citysearch and Wikipedia, in addition to input from other users) to serve up info on absolutely anything you want. From the launch page, you choose specific categories (restaurants, accommodations, games, sights and so-on) to explore. In terms of sheer breadth of options no other app comes close—you may even see other people’s personal Flickr photos and comments on any given place or attraction.
Yelp Monocle
Turns out the regular app for getting the thin on nearby businesses has a clever Easter Egg in-built: Click on the "More" tab at the underside of the screen, select Monocle and presto, you’ve got got a handy AR viewer. Point your smartphone where you are heading and you will see tabs pop up showing you business names and reviews (click tabs at the underside of the screen to see restaurants, bars, friends or the whole lot). Hold your phone flat and it switches to map view so you may make a beeline to essentially the most enticing option.
